分布式追踪赋能网站逻辑架构与视觉质感
|
在当今数字化浪潮中,网站作为企业与用户交互的核心窗口,其性能与用户体验直接影响业务转化率。然而,随着微服务架构的普及,系统复杂度呈指数级增长,传统监控手段难以精准定位跨服务调用链中的性能瓶颈。分布式追踪技术通过为每个请求生成唯一标识并记录全链路调用信息,成为破解复杂系统可观测性的关键工具。它不仅能帮助开发者快速定位故障根源,更能在架构优化与用户体验提升层面发挥深层价值,为网站逻辑架构与视觉质感带来双重赋能。 分布式追踪的核心价值在于构建全链路可视化地图。当用户访问一个电商网站的商品详情页时,请求可能涉及商品服务、库存服务、推荐系统、图片CDN等多个组件。传统监控只能看到单个服务的响应时间,而分布式追踪系统如Jaeger或Zipkin能将分散的调用日志串联成完整的时序图。通过分析调用链中的耗时分布,团队可以精准识别出是某个微服务响应缓慢,还是数据库查询存在瓶颈,或是第三方API调用超时。这种从"局部感知"到"全局洞察"的转变,使架构优化从经验驱动转向数据驱动,避免因盲目扩容或代码重构导致的资源浪费。 在逻辑架构层面,分布式追踪推动着系统向更健壮的方向演进。当追踪数据揭示某个服务频繁成为性能瓶颈时,团队可以针对性地实施架构优化:通过缓存策略减少数据库访问,采用异步处理解耦核心流程,或引入服务网格实现智能路由。某金融科技公司的案例显示,在部署分布式追踪后,其支付系统平均故障修复时间从2小时缩短至15分钟,系统可用性提升至99.99%。这种可观测性带来的架构韧性,直接转化为更稳定的用户体验——页面加载时间波动减少,交易流程中断率显著下降,用户对平台的信任度随之提升。 视觉质感的提升同样离不开分布式追踪的支撑。现代网站追求"零感知"加载体验,但前端性能优化常因缺乏后端调用数据而陷入盲区。通过将追踪数据与前端性能指标关联分析,团队可以发现:某个API的响应延迟导致页面渲染卡顿,或图片压缩服务的不稳定影响了视觉流畅度。某新闻门户网站利用追踪数据优化后,首屏加载时间从3.2秒降至1.8秒,其中关键改进点包括:合并不必要的API调用、预加载高频访问资源、对低优先级请求实施降级处理。这些优化不仅让页面"看起来更快",更通过数据验证确保了每项改进都能带来可量化的体验提升。 分布式追踪的实施需要构建完整的技术栈。从代码层的埋点采集,到传输层的协议标准(如OpenTelemetry),再到存储层的时序数据库,每个环节都需精心设计。特别在微服务环境中,跨团队的数据标准化至关重要——统一TraceID生成规则、定义清晰的Span标签体系、建立合理的采样策略,这些基础工作决定了追踪系统的可用性。某跨国企业的实践表明,通过制定内部追踪规范并配套自动化工具链,其全系统追踪数据覆盖率从40%提升至92%,为持续优化提供了坚实的数据基础。
2026效果图由AI设计,仅供参考 展望未来,分布式追踪将与AIOps深度融合,实现从被动监控到主动预测的跨越。通过机器学习分析历史追踪数据,系统可以自动识别异常模式并提前预警,甚至在故障发生前就触发扩容或熔断机制。这种智能化的可观测性体系,将使网站能够以更低的运维成本提供始终如一的优质体验。当逻辑架构的健壮性与视觉质感的细腻度形成良性互动,企业便能真正构建起数字化时代的核心竞争力——一个既"跑得稳"又"看起来美"的智能网站。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

